From 7c168bb4deb77ff22f178e1b8091446fde674e29 Mon Sep 17 00:00:00 2001
From: gaoluyang <2820782392@qq.com>
Date: 星期三, 12 三月 2025 11:18:09 +0800
Subject: [PATCH] 设备搬迁-设备档案联调
---
src/api/cnas/resourceDemand/device.js | 14 +++++++-------
src/views/CNAS/resourceDemand/device/index.vue | 6 +++---
src/views/CNAS/resourceDemand/device/component/files.vue | 5 ++---
3 files changed, 12 insertions(+), 13 deletions(-)
diff --git a/src/api/cnas/resourceDemand/device.js b/src/api/cnas/resourceDemand/device.js
index 635890a..08b9d6d 100644
--- a/src/api/cnas/resourceDemand/device.js
+++ b/src/api/cnas/resourceDemand/device.js
@@ -660,7 +660,7 @@
//鏂板璁惧妗f
export function addDocument(data) {
return request({
- url: "/deviceDocuments/addDocument",
+ url: "/documents/add",
method: "post",
data: data,
});
@@ -669,7 +669,7 @@
// 鑾峰彇鐩稿叧鏂囨。鏁版嵁鐨刟pi-鏇存柊
export function updateDocument(data) {
return request({
- url: "/deviceDocuments/updateDocument",
+ url: "/documents/updateDocument",
method: "post",
data: data,
});
@@ -678,7 +678,7 @@
//鍒犻櫎璁惧妗f
export function deleteDocumentById(query) {
return request({
- url: "/deviceDocuments/deleteDocumentById",
+ url: "/documents/delete",
method: "delete",
params: query,
});
@@ -814,9 +814,9 @@
}
//鏌ヨ璁惧妗f鍒楄〃
-export function getAllDocuments(query) {
+export function getListByDId(query) {
return request({
- url: `/deviceDocuments/getAllDocuments`,
+ url: '/documents/getListByDId',
method: "get",
params: query,
});
@@ -1283,10 +1283,10 @@
params: query,
});
}
-//璁惧棰勭害鎺ュ彛
+// 璁惧杩愯鎬昏-鏍规嵁id鑾峰彇璁惧鏁呴殰鏁版嵁
export function device(query) {
return request({
- url: "/api/device-faults/device",
+ url: "/deviceFaults/device",
method: "get",
params: query,
});
diff --git a/src/views/CNAS/resourceDemand/device/component/files.vue b/src/views/CNAS/resourceDemand/device/component/files.vue
index feabc51..1850918 100644
--- a/src/views/CNAS/resourceDemand/device/component/files.vue
+++ b/src/views/CNAS/resourceDemand/device/component/files.vue
@@ -470,11 +470,10 @@
updateDocument,
addDocument,
deleteDocumentById,
- getAllDocuments,
selectDeviceByCode,
upDeviceParameter,
exportDeviceFile,
- getInsProduction,
+ getInsProduction, getListByDId,
} from '@/api/cnas/resourceDemand/device.js'
import { selectUserCondition } from "@/api/system/user";
import {
@@ -719,7 +718,7 @@
},
// 鑾峰彇鐩稿叧鏂囨。鏁版嵁鐨刟pi
getPage() {
- getAllDocuments({ deviceId: this.clickNodeVal.value }).then(res => {
+ getListByDId({ id: this.clickNodeVal.value }).then(res => {
if (res.code == 200)
this.tableDataA = res.data
})
diff --git a/src/views/CNAS/resourceDemand/device/index.vue b/src/views/CNAS/resourceDemand/device/index.vue
index 8206ced..a12de51 100644
--- a/src/views/CNAS/resourceDemand/device/index.vue
+++ b/src/views/CNAS/resourceDemand/device/index.vue
@@ -47,7 +47,7 @@
<div v-if="!isShowAll" style="height: 100%;">
<el-tabs v-model="tabListActiveName" class="main_right" type="border-card" @tab-click="handleClick">
<el-tab-pane label="璁惧杩愯鎬昏" name="璁惧杩愯鎬昏">
- <operationOverview v-if="tabListActiveName == '璁惧杩愯鎬昏'" :clickNodeVal="clickNodeVal"/>
+ <operationOverview view v-if="tabListActiveName == '璁惧杩愯鎬昏'" :clickNodeVal="clickNodeVal"/>
</el-tab-pane>
<el-tab-pane label="璁惧妗f" name="璁惧妗f">
<files v-if="tabListActiveName == '璁惧妗f'" :clickNodeVal="clickNodeVal" />
@@ -123,7 +123,7 @@
isShowAll: true,
deviceName: "", // 渚ц竟鏍忔悳绱�
loading: false,
- tabListActiveName: '璁惧妗f',
+ tabListActiveName: '璁惧杩愯鎬昏',
menuListActiveName: '璁惧鎬昏',
list: [],
clickNodeVal: {}
@@ -200,7 +200,7 @@
.device-right {
background: #fff;
width: calc(100% - 250px);
- height: calc(100vh - 100px);
+ height: calc(100vh - 40px);
border-radius: 16px;
box-sizing: border-box;
padding: 10px;
--
Gitblit v1.9.3